Tarjei Sandvik Moe
Tarjei Sandvik Moe, born on May 24, 1999, is a prominent Norwegian actor celebrated for his compelling performance in the acclaimed teen drama series Skam, aired on NRK. In the show's third season, he portrayed the lead character, Isak Valtersen, a role that captured the hearts of many viewers and resonated throughout all four seasons of the series.
In recognition of his outstanding portrayal, Moe received a nomination for Best Actor at the prestigious Gullruten Awards in 2017, underscoring his impact within the Norwegian television landscape. His character, Isak, not only garnered critical acclaim but was also nominated for the Audience Award alongside his co-star Henrik Holm, who played Even Bech Næsheim. Together, they achieved notable success by winning both the Audience Award and the 'Best TV Moment' accolade for the unforgettable "O Helga Natt" scene from Season 3.
In addition to his acting career, Moe is a student at Hartvig Nissen School, the same institution that serves as the backdrop for Skam.
